Output e28696a32ca34b7c79cc085fdfff70ec39f359d559de4e2717f02386190f37d0:25

value
18289725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7aef7ef22672ebbf4d70568399ea3d67a41f46f OP_EQUAL
address
3KtqzjzMUdHTMLvEQkBNwDzi4759gqvjjy
transaction
e28696a32ca34b7c79cc085fdfff70ec39f359d559de4e2717f02386190f37d0
spent
true